The Milled or Broken Rice market in Estonia reached a value of 3.3258 million euros in 2023. Over the last decade, the market experienced minor fluctuations, with value changes mostly confined within a narrow band. Year-on-year variations have shown limited dynamics, with slight increases or decreases revealing market stability. The last five years have been marked by subtle changes, with a CAGR of 0.3%. This indicates a stable yet modestly growing market nearing equilibrium.
